Abstract

En partant de l'exemple FRANCE TELECOM, cette communication a pour objet de discuter les conditions pour réussir une hybridation entre administration et entreprise. La Direction Générale des Télécommunications a beau s'auto- baptiser FRANCE TELECOM pour faire comme BRITISH TELECOM, elle a l'allure d'une entreprise, le style de gestion d'une entreprise, les contraintes d'exploitation d'une entreprise... mais c'est encore une administration centrale. Pour combien de temps ?
